Even a coffee table can become a piece of art if it can stand regardless of the typological limitations. Fredrikson Stallard address the issue with the strength of the material to be bent and shaped. The result is a completely new form, marked by an important, and expressionistic, depression in the center of the top.
Finishes:
Structure in fiberglass lacquered white, gold or blue
Dimensions:
1140 x 900 x H380 mm
